Fortifying Government Using CDM
Congress established the Continuous Diagnostics and Mitigation (CDM) Program to provide adequate, risk-based, and cost-effective cybersecurity and more efficiently allocate cybersecurity resources. The CDM Program provides agencies with capabilities and tools to identify cybersecurity risks on an ongoing basis, prioritize these risks based on potential impacts, and enable cybersecurity personnel to mitigate the most significant problems first....

Accelerating Citizen Services using Acc...
As more citizens access government services online and via mobile devices, the need for effective and accessible digital forms increases. According to the President’s Management Agenda, there are more than 23,000 different forms inside the federal government that lead to 11.4 billion hours of paperwork annually and result in a poor user experience.
